Description: You will be the Machine Shop Quality Engineer Senior for the Machining Operations Center. Our team is responsible for delivering high‑quality machined components and assemblies that meet stringent aerospace standards.
What You Will Be Doing
As the Machine Shop Quality Engineer Senior you will be responsible for establishing and maintaining quality excellence across our machining operations.
Your responsibilities will include, but are not limited to:
-
Develop and review quality standards, work instructions, and inspection procedures for manufactured and procured parts.
-
Lead Material Review Boards and Failure Review Boards to drive root‑cause analysis and corrective actions.
-
Perform audits and assessments to ensure compliance with ISO‑9001 / AS9100 and engineering specifications.
-
Interface with customers, suppliers, and program personnel on quality‑related issues.
-
Implement new inspection processes and automation methods to improve efficiency.

Basic Qualifications:
-STEM Degree at a Bachelor level or above or equivalent experience/combined education
-Ability to interpret drawings an specifications for development of quality standards, methods, work instructions and procedures for inspect of manufactured products (machined components and assemblies)
-In-depth understanding of GD&T principles (ASME Y14.5-2009) and application
-Demonstrated ability to use casual analysis tools to analyze and resolve technical/process issues
-Proficient skill level with Microsoft Office applications
Desired Skills:
-STEM Degree at a Bachelor level or above preferred
-CMM programming experience
-Experience with automated processes and robotic technologies
-Lean / Six Sigma Green or Black Belt certification
-Special Process Engineering experience
-SAP Application experience
-Experience with use of inspection gages and measuring equipment
-Experience with material review board requirements, evaluating risk and impact to overall system requirements
-Demonstrated understanding of audit techniques
